Abstract

Provided herein are methods of treating subjects having tumors. For example, the invention relates to a method for treating subjects having hepatocellular carcinoma by administering an effective amount of a therapeutic prodrug.

Claims (64)

1 . A method of treating a subject having a tumor comprising administering an effective amount of the prodrug G-202 to said subject.

2 . The method of claim 1 , wherein said effective amount of said prodrug is administered for at least one day of a 28-day cycle.

3 . The method of claim 2 , wherein said effective amount of said prodrug comprises administering at least about 40 mg/m 2 of said prodrug.

4 . The method of claim 3 , wherein said effective amount of said prodrug comprises administering at least about 60 mg/m 2 of said prodrug.

5 . The method of claim 4 , wherein said effective amount of said prodrug comprises administering at least about 80 mg/m 2 of said prodrug.

6 . The method of claim 2 , wherein said effective amount of said prodrug is administered for at least two consecutive days.

7 . The method of claim 6 , wherein said at least two consecutive days occurs at the beginning of a 28-day cycle.

8 . The method of claim 7 , wherein said effective amount of said prodrug comprises administering about 40 mg/m 2 of said prodrug on day 1, and about 66.8 mg/m 2 of said prodrug on day 2.

9 . The method of claim 7 , wherein said effective amount of said prodrug comprises administering about 40 mg/m 2 of said prodrug on days 1 and 2.

10 . The method of claim 6 , wherein said effective amount of said prodrug is administered for at least three consecutive days.

11 . The method of claim 10 , wherein said at least three consecutive days occurs at the beginning of a 28-day cycle.

12 . The method of claim 11 , wherein said effective amount of said prodrug comprises administering about 40 mg/m 2 of said prodrug on day 1, and about 66.8 mg/m 2 of said prodrug on each of days 2 and 3.

13 . The method of claim 11 , wherein said effective amount of said prodrug comprises administering about 40 mg/m 2 of said prodrug on days 1, 2 and 3.

14 . The method of claim 1 , wherein said tumor is selected from the group consisting of prostate cancer, hepatocellular carcinoma and glioblastoma.

15 . The method of claim 2 , wherein said 28-day cycle is repeated at least once.

16 . The method of claim 2 , wherein administration is selected from the group consisting of intravenous, intramuscular, subcutaneous, implantable pump, continuous infusion, liposomal and oral administration.

17 . The method of claim 16 , wherein said prodrug is administered via infusion.

18 . The method of claim 16 , wherein said prodrug is administered via injection.

19 . The method of claim 16 , wherein said prodrug is administered in combination with chemotherapy, surgery, other procedure, other anti-cancer agent(s) or other therapeutic methods.

20 . The method of claim 19 , wherein said prodrug is administered prior to surgery.

21 . The method of claim 20 , wherein said prodrug is administered for at least two 28-day cycles.
